Indian culture is one of the oldest in human history. Many of its achievements have had a significant influence on the Western world. For example, the plots of a considerable number of European fairy tales trace back to Indian originals.... At the same time, the image of a distant fairy-tale country has inspired European authors for centuries to create amazing stories that captivate with their originality and colorfulness. This edition collects retellings of myths and legends, adaptations of fables and fairy tales, as well as summaries of what the ancient Greeks wrote about India. In the pages of this book, young readers will get acquainted with the diversity of Indian mythology and also meet famous ancient heroes such as Alexander the Great. The text is accompanied by illustrations of ancient sculptures, medieval Indian miniatures, and paintings by artists. All unfamiliar names and terms are explained with comments and margin notes to make the acquaintance with new material easy, engaging, and comfortable.
